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5677 81301629729 3831148503 3087245
76258 173345869 7107
76258 173345869 7107
71607046 75094937 72673 76
All about undefined
Interested in learning more?
76258 173345869 7107
71607046 75094937 72673 76
See more
2767126 440
7842047 0893 188798
See more
0149500422 43846401
03904519 638552 209
See more